(Day 31): Get Off Social Media Because It’s Stressing You Out!

 

Can I tell you first off… I LOVE SOCIAL MEDIA! To be honest, probably TOO much. However it can also be a detriment in many ways if I’m not careful.

 

Honestly I believe there is value in social media and it’s not all bad. I’ve made great friendship connections to people I would never have met if it wasn’t for social media. I’ve stayed connected with lifelong friends from across the nation, overseas, and in different continents of the world because of social media. I’ve kept in contact with family members all the more because of social media. Shoot, I’m even able to be doing what I’m doing all the more (writing a book + speaking) because of the influence social media has had on my creative abilities.

 

However, if there’s a few things I’ve learned with the use of social media, proper boundaries definitely have to be in place. I need these boundaries so I don’t get stressed out, depressed, find myself in the comparison trap, or zapped of my creative energies. Sometimes I have to cut it out completely for a while because I’m just so saturated in the negative aspects it can bring to my life.

 

With that said, I encourage you to take a fast and GET OFF SOCIAL MEDIA for a few days, a few weeks, heck even a month or more if you have any of the tendencies right now to what I shared above (anxiety, depression, comparison, anger, lonely, etc) and INVEST in the LIFE BLOOD relationships around you! Or invest into yourself personally by doing things that have been taking up your time and energy by scrolling through social media feeds!

 

And guess what? I will do it with you. Right after posting this I will be taking a full week off social media so I can purge some of the anxiety I’ve felt from it and invest in my family because I’ve been too distracted and it’s been sapping my creative energies (can you tell?!)

 

Life is too short to be so consumed virtually. We are getting too stressed out by being so overly exposed to social media so readily. We need to live life tangibly so we have enough life in us to live life fully.
